The goal of crypto trading is to make money by buying and selling cryptocurrencies. Cryptocurrencies are digital or virtual currencies that don’t have a central bank and use cryptography for security.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in are a few of the most well-known altcoins.
On cryptocurrency platforms, users can buy and sell different cryptocurrencies using fiat currencies or other cryptocurrencies.
To make money trading cryptocurrencies, you have to look at market trends and make smart choices about when to buy and sell. Traders can make better choices with the help of tools and strategies like technical analysis.
Some traders also buy and sell cryptocurrencies within the same day to take advantage of small price changes. This is called “day trading.”
It’s important to remember that dealing in cryptocurrencies can be risky because their prices can change quickly and be very volatile. Because of this, traders should think carefully about their investment strategies and how much danger they are willing to take before getting into crypto trading.

2. Luno
Luno is a cryptocurrency exchange and digital wallet that allows users to buy, sell, and store various cryptocurrencies. It was founded in 2013 by Marcus Swanepoel and Timothy Stranex, with its headquarters located in London, United Kingdom. Luno operates in over 40 countries and supports several popular c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), and Bitcoin Cash (BCH).
As an exchange, Luno provides a platform for users to trade cryptocurrencies with other users on the platform. It offers a user-friendly interface and provides tools and charts to help users analyze market trends and make informed trading decisions.
In addition to trading, Luno also offers a digital wallet where users can securely store their cryptocurrencies. The wallet provides features such as sending and receiving cryptocurrencies, as well as the ability to convert between different supported cryptocurrencies within the wallet.

6. Paxful
Paxful is a peer-to-peer cryptocurrency marketplace that allows users to buy and sell Bitcoin (BTC) and other cryptocurrencies directly with each other. It was founded in 2015 by Ray Youssef and Artur Schaback and is headquartered in New York City, USA.
Paxful operates as an online platform where buyers and sellers can connect and trade cryptocurrencies using various payment methods such as bank transfers, cash deposits, digital wallets, gift cards, and more. The platform acts as an escrow service, holding the seller’s cryptocurrency until the buyer’s payment is confirmed, ensuring a secure transaction for both parties.

9. Remitano
Remitano is a global peer-to-peer cryptocurrency trading platform that allows users to buy and sell various cryptocurrencies, such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Tether. It was founded in 2014 and has gained popularity for its easy-to-use interface and secure trading environment.
On Remitano, users can create an account, deposit funds, and start trading cryptocurrencies with other users. The platform acts as an intermediary, providing escrow services to ensure the safety of transactions. When a trade is initiated, the seller’s cryptocurrency is held in escrow until the buyer confirms the payment, ensuring a secure and reliable trading process.
Remitano supports multiple payment methods, including bank transfers, cash deposits, and various online payment systems, depending on the region. Users can choose their preferred payment method and currency to facilitate trades with other users.

Crypto Arbitrage In Nigeria
Crypto arbitrage in Nigeria refers to the practice of taking advantage of price differences between different cryptocurrency exchanges or markets to make a profit. This entails purchasing a cryptocurrency at a lower price on one exchange and selling it at a higher price on another exchange. Profit is derived from the price difference between the two exchanges, minus transaction fees and other expenses.
Numerous factors, such as differences in exchange fees, liquidity, and demand, can give rise to arbitrage opportunities. There are numerous crypto exchanges and markets in Nigeria, each with its own prices and trading volumes. This can create opportunities for merchants to capitalise on price differences between platforms.
To engage in crypto arbitrage in Nigeria, traders must be able to monitor prices on various exchanges in real-time and implement trades swiftly. This requires a high level of knowledge and skill, as well as access to trading tools and platforms that can provide market data and analysis in real time. Some traders employ algorithms or automated trading software to help them identify and execute arbitrage opportunities with greater speed and efficiency.
It is essential to note that crypto arbitrage can be a high-risk strategy, given that prices can be highly volatile and subject to rapid fluctuations. Before engaging in crypto arbitrage or any other type of crypto trading, it is necessary to thoroughly consider your investment strategies and risk tolerance.
